What does the word "Inactivate" mean?

The term "inactivate" is derived from the prefix "in-" meaning "not" or "opposite of," and the root word "activate," which refers to making something operational or functional. Therefore, to inactivate something means to render it inactive or not capable of functioning. The process of inactivation is significant for various reasons. In medical science, using inactivated vaccines has been a critical strategy to safely immunize people against diseases. By using organisms that can no longer replicate, scientists encourage the body to build an immune response without the risk of causing illness. Similarly, inactivation mechanisms are critical for ensuring safety in chemical processes, preventing unwanted reactions that could lead to hazardous situations.
